Transaction 35a5765f063c56098364c84db8dfd9342cfd99ec962fd5b216c73dd4c7aefce0
1 Input
2 Outputs
- 35a5765f063c56098364c84db8dfd9342cfd99ec962fd5b216c73dd4c7aefce0:0
- 35a5765f063c56098364c84db8dfd9342cfd99ec962fd5b216c73dd4c7aefce0:1
value 137893
address 1Gf2LCwtCCpGR6mCv29gMdvKLaRmZLi1kD
value 74610372
address 3HbvMCf3rXfyGSkETMtsUqTMysj25dwF3q